About Bellingrath Gardens And Home
Bellingrath Gardens and Home is a stunning botanical garden and historical estate located in Theodore, Alabama. This enchanting place is more than just a garden; it is a place where visitors can immerse themselves in nature and history. The gardens span over 65 acres and are filled with beautiful trees, flowering plants, and uniquely designed garden beds. Established by Walter and Bessie Bellingrath, the gardens were opened to the public in 1932, and they have been delighting visitors ever since.
The estate also showcases Bellingrath Home, a historic structure built in 1935, which is a grand representation of Southern architecture. Guests can tour the house, which is filled with antiques and period furnishings that tell the story of the Bellingrath family’s past. The ambiance of the gardens and home captures the essence of the Gulf Coast’s natural beauty and history.
One of the most impressive features of this garden estate is its themed gardens. The Rose Garden is particularly breathtaking, with thousands of roses blooming at various times of the year. In addition, the Asian-American Garden showcases plants and design elements from both cultures, blending them in a way that creates a serene space. Other notable sections of the garden include the Camellia Parterre and the Great Lawn, each offering distinct beauty and charm.
Visitors will also find the Delchamps Gallery of Boehm Porcelain on the estate, displaying exquisite pieces that highlight the beauty of porcelain arts. The gallery offers a unique insight into the intricate craftsmanship involved in creating these sculptures. Furthermore, the chapel on the estate grounds serves as a serene spot for reflection, adding yet another layer to the beauty and tranquility of Bellingrath Gardens.

Things to Do In Bellingrath Gardens And Home
While the gardens themselves are the main attraction, there are numerous activities to engage in while visiting Bellingrath Gardens and Home. To fully appreciate this estate, take your time exploring the various themed gardens, each designed to showcase different plant species and landscaping styles.
Start with the Rose Garden, which is home to over 1,200 roses. This garden features a variety of colors and species, each blooming at different times throughout the year. Walking through the Rose Garden can be a truly magical experience as you take in the soothing scents and vibrant colors.
Next, make your way to the Asian-American Garden, where you can appreciate the harmonious blend of Eastern and Western influences in both plant selection and design. The charming ponds and tranquil pathways create a peaceful atmosphere, perfect for meditation or a leisurely stroll.
The Camellia Parterre is another highlight. Camellias bloom in the winter and early spring, providing beautiful blossoms during the cooler months. This part of the garden showcases the stunning hues of pink, red, and white that these flowers offer, providing a brilliant contrast to the evergreen leaves.
Take time to tour the historic Bellingrath Home, where you can explore the 15 rooms filled with antiques, family memorabilia, and original artworks. The guided tours often enhance your understanding of the home’s history and the lives lived within its walls. The stories shared by the guides breathe life into the estate, making the rich past come alive.
Don’t forget to visit the Delchamps Gallery of Boehm Porcelain. This gallery includes rare and beautiful porcelain sculptures that are not just valuable, but also significant pieces of art. The attention to detail in each creation may inspire visitors to appreciate the craftsmanship behind porcelain works.

Bellingrath Gardens And Home Location & How To Get There
Bellingrath Gardens and Home is located at 12401 Bellingrath Gardens Road, Theodore, AL 36582. The estate is conveniently situated for visitors coming from major nearby cities, making access easy. Here are the directions for those traveling from several locations:
For those coming from Mobile, you will take I-10 W towards Pascagoula, exit 15A toward Theodore, then take US 90 south. Turn left onto Bellingrath Road, continue onto Rebel Road, and straight onto Bellingrath Gardens Road.
If you’re traveling from New Orleans, take I-10 East into Mobile, AL. You will take Exit 13 for Theodore Dawes Road and then US Highway 90. Turn right on US Highway 90 and left onto Bellingrath Road for about six miles before turning left onto Bellingrath Gardens Road.
For visitors coming from Pensacola, you will take I-10 West into Mobile, AL. Take Exit 15A (Highway 90 – Theodore) then continue for 2 miles. Turn left onto Bellingrath Road at the Bellingrath billboard, continuing south for about six miles before turning left onto Bellingrath Gardens Road.

Fort Conde
Fort Conde is a historical landmark located in Mobile, Alabama, that offers visitors a glimpse into the city’s military history. The site features a replica of the original fort that was built by the French in the 1700s. Visitors can take guided tours to learn about the fort’s significance in the region and listen to captivating stories from the past.
Fort Conde provides an intriguing way to understand the early days of Mobile and the impact of the fort on city development. It is a great stop for history buffs and those wishing to connect with the local heritage.
